RRaghunath C G NairAmazing! Fascinating! Fanjingshan was the final stop of our memorable 10-day tour of Guizhou Province, and we truly could not have chosen a better place to conclude our journey. We felt genuinely blessed to stay at this lovely guesthouse for three nights. From the very beginning, the owner Mr. Zhang Haotian and his family made us feel completely at home; they were warm, engaging, attentive, and always ready to help with a smile.
The rooms are tastefully designed and thoughtfully laid out, perfectly sized for comfort. Our room offered a soothing view of the river, along with a private balcony; an ideal spot to relax with your favourite tea or coffee. The modern touches were impressive too, especially the high-tech sensor toilet, which added a pleasant surprise. The three-storey guesthouse is equipped with an elevator, a thoughtful convenience for guests with heavy luggage or those who may find climbing stairs challenging.
Dinner, lovingly cooked by the family, was absolutely delicious, with generous portions that reflected both their hospitality and culinary skill. Every meal felt homely and satisfying. We only wish we had taken more and better photographs of the guesthouse. Without a doubt, this is one place we will return to.
As for the enchanting Fanjing Mountain itself, the owner drove us to the scenic area entrance. He even offered to pick us up later, but we chose to walk back instead, enjoying the cool climate. Fanjing Mountain is magical in its own right. The steep cable car ride to the summit, which takes over 20 minutes, was an experience in itself, offering breathtaking views of the mountain ranges stretching endlessly around us. At the top stands the age-old Buddhist temple, serene and awe-inspiring, perfectly harmonising with its natural surroundings.
We loved the guesthouse, we are very grateful to Mr. Zhang and his family for their kindness, and deeply thankful for the unforgettable experience at Fanjing Mountain. It was the perfect ending to a remarkable journey.

Cchrischan1609First: this place is not a Carlton Hotel chain hotel. It is a rip off name.
Secondly: it is located on the 8th floor of a commercial tower.
As a 3 star rated hotel in china, it's on the high end of the scale inside.
as a solo traveller, i am mainly looking at convenience and hygiene. I booked this place for it's proximity to the train station for my early morning flight.
Arriving at the station, it took me 40 minutes to find my way to walk over to the hotel, and would have appreciated more information.
How to get there: Exit the station at the west plaza, on your right somewhere, you will find a path which leads to an underpass to cross the highway. Walk straight into the basement of the commercial building, turn left and then go up the escalators. Then the hotel's lifts are on the left as you enter the building. The current state of the elevator lobby and the lift is dire. See photos. Cigarette butts, and renovation mess.
In the reception, there was a lady in front of me that was haggling the prices of her room. Just so that you get an idea of the place.
Once I got into the room, it was fine. Quite a nice area. But there was no Aircon control, it was all centralised, but at least it was cool in Guiyang that night.
There was a wet mark on the sofa, see photo. I inspected the room for hygiene, and it was ok, clean towels, clean toilet, clean sheets, pillows didn't smell. The toilet flushes well, and shower room was clean. In fact, apart from the sofa mark and the rug condition, everything was good. I marked down the hygiene mainly from a suspicious wet mark and the state of the lobby/lift.
I used the self checkout in the morning to catch my train, since the reception was sleeping under the counter. It takes 10-15 min today walk to the station with luggage, with no rain shelter. Be aware. It is probably better to just book a hotel in a slightly better area and take a cab.
